TerraPower is a nuclear technology company based in Bellevue, Washington. At its core, the company is working to raise living standards globally through a more affordable, secure, and environmentally friendly form of nuclear energy along with innovations in medical isotopes to improve human health.

Qualifications and Skills
- Bachelor's degree in environmental health and safety, environmental science, occupational safety, industrial hygiene, or a related field
- 5+ years of experience in Occupational or Environmental Health and Safety
- 2+ years administering or supporting EHS management systems, software platforms, or other database-driven tools
-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ities
- Ability to multi-task to manage shifting priorities and to follow through on projects with minimal supervision
- Ability to work cross-functionally with various teams
- Strong knowledge of EHS laws and regulations relevant to site operations
- Certifications in quality management, such as LEAN or Six Sigma is a plus
- Strong organizational and communication skills
- Experience in a lab, manufacturing, or industrial environment
Responsibilities
- Coordinate the development, review, update, and distribution of EHS written programs, policies, and procedures, and supporting documentation
- Maintain document control processes for EHS programs, including revision tracking, version control, approvals, record retention, and archiving
- Administer and maintain EHS software systems, including data entry, record accuracy, user support, report generation, and workflow tracking
- Develop and maintain EHS content and document libraries within SharePoint, Confluence, and other internal platforms to ensure information is organized, accessible, and current
